Our Customer Service team members represent the Benjamin Moore brand by creating best in class customer experiences. The ideal candidate will have a passion for people and will maintain a positive, empathetic, and professional attitude. They will be adaptable, mindful, and humble. We are looking for someone who can work cohesively with customers and colleagues from diverse backgrounds to achieve a common goal.

This position is for the late shift in our Customer Experience team, with typical hours of 11am-7pm or 12pm-8pm EST, based on business needs.

Responsibilities

  • Process customer orders accurately across multiple data entry models while adhering to all target deadlines to ensure compliance with company service level agreements.
  • Supply information to customers about orders, deliveries, product availability, pricing, and promotions.
  • Communicate with Logistics personnel to coordinate special delivery requirements and to resolve problems with product availability.
  • Maintain accountability and a cheerful demeanor while handling inquiries, building strong relationships with customers and colleagues.
  • Demonstrate emotional intelligence, working effectively with diverse individuals and actively seeking feedback for professional growth.
  • Navigates systems, procedures, and other resources adeptly to provide accurate and prompt resolution to customer inquiries.
  • Prioritizes and manages multiple tasks simultaneously in an office environment with tight deadlines.
  • Embraces change, adapting to a constantly evolving market and applying new training knowledge consistently to deliver excellent customer service.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.

About Benjamin Moore

We've been dreaming in color since 1883.

Benjamin Moore & Co., a subsidiary of Berkshire Hathaway, stands at the forefront of innovation and design with a commitment to research and development unrivaled in the architectural coatings industry. We are proud to set the standard of excellence and remain committed to the vision of our founder, Benjamin Moore, in producing the highest-quality paints and finishes and delivering them directly to our customers through our network of more than 7,500 independent retail locations.

Building on our company tradition of giving back where we live and work, Benjamin Moore supports programs that enrich our communities. We are invested in reducing our impact on the planet and offering a safe and inclusive workplace for all.
